#1cb669 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1cb669 is composed of 11% red, 71.4%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 42.3%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 150 degrees, a saturation of 73.3% and a lightness of 41.2%. #1cb669 color hex could be obtained by blending #38ffd2 with #006d00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

Shades and Tints of #1cb669
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020c07 is the darkest color, while #fafef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#1cb669
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656d69 is the less saturated color, while #04ce69 is the most saturated one.
